Donald Trump's Truth Social Posting Spree: Addressing Health Rumors

9/2/2025, 12:55:55 AM

Surge in Health Speculation

Following a four-day absence from public view, President Donald Trump, 79, took to his social media platform, Truth Social, to dispel rampant rumors regarding his health and even claims of his death. Speculation intensified after Trump was seen with visible health issues, including swollen ankles and bruised hands, which were attributed to chronic venous insufficiency, a condition affecting blood circulation. His absence coincided with a lack of scheduled public appearances, leading to a surge of online chatter, with hashtags like #whereistrump and #TRUMPDIED trending on social media platforms.

A Digital Response

In a bid to quell the rumors, Trump launched an extensive posting spree on Saturday, sharing over 40 posts in just 10 hours. His content ranged from political commentary to AI-generated memes and videos. Among the notable posts were images depicting Trump in various fantastical roles, such as a police officer and a SWAT team member, alongside a dramatic image of him in front of a fiery Earth with the message, “The world will soon understand nothing can stop what is coming.” One of the most shared videos showcased a montage of his life set to the song "Forever Young" by Alphaville, which Trump linked to twice, expressing admiration for its creation.

Political Commentary and Personal Anecdotes

Trump's posts also included a mix of political commentary, where he discussed topics such as tariffs, voter ID laws, and critiques of political figures like Federal Reserve Governor Lisa Cook and California Governor Gavin Newsom. He recounted a detailed and somewhat bizarre incident regarding damage to the White House Rose Garden, blaming a subcontractor for the issue and praising his security cameras for capturing the event.

Official Statements and Responses

In response to the health rumors, the White House maintained that Trump is in good health, attributing his physical symptoms to benign conditions and frequent handshakes. Trump himself declared on Truth Social that he had “NEVER FELT BETTER IN MY LIFE,” attempting to reassure his supporters amid the swirling speculation.

Criticism and Opposition

Critics have labeled Trump's posting spree as "unhinged," questioning the appropriateness of his content given the serious nature of health concerns. Some commentators expressed concern over the implications of a sitting president engaging in such dramatic social media theatrics, especially in light of his access to sensitive information and responsibilities.

Conflicting Reports and Gaps

While Trump's team asserts that he is mentally and physically fit, the visible signs of health issues have led to mixed perceptions among the public and media. Observers noted that despite the White House's assurances, the president's recent health challenges have raised legitimate questions about his well-being and capacity to fulfill his duties.
